couchdb-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From Noah Slater <>
Subject Re: CouchDB code coverage and profiling
Date Thu, 03 Jul 2008 14:07:35 GMT
On Thu, Jul 03, 2008 at 03:47:09PM +0200, Jan Lehnardt wrote:
> Yeah, I don't know what the right place is, but it'd be nice if it was easy
> for a developer or tester to access. A flag will do for profiling, but not for
> the coverage (unless we implicitly recompile CouchDB which I don't think is a
> good idea).
> What about installing the source dir with the beam files? It appears to be not
> uncommon in the free software Erlang world to have a module-x.y.z/ebin for the
> beam files and module-x.z.y/src for the sources.

Okay, you have a point. Perhaps something like:

  ./configure --with-profiling --with-coverage

This would be more elegant that cluttering up `couchdb` or similar.

As for the ebin/src, sure, though we originally did that but one of my Debian
Erlang mentors suggested that it wasn't necessary, so I took it out.


Noah Slater,

View raw message